Collecting evidence

It is important to collect evidence in any personal injury case. If you're involved in a truck crash the evidence you collect could be more crucial. A truck accident lawyer can help you collect evidence and also know how to present it to the court.

There are many ways that you can collect evidence, like taking photos, speaking with witnesses, and calling law enforcement. You may also be able to collect information from surveillance cameras that are close to the accident site.

After you've collected evidence it's important to store the evidence in a secure area until you are ready to use it in your case. It's possible to do this in many ways, but the most effective is to seal the items with a unique number and place them in a bag. This will keep the items safe for any forensic tests that may be required.

A reputable lawyer for truck accidents can help you identify all possible people responsible for the accident and ensure that they are held accountable. They can also help you determine the amount you should receive in a settlement.

Lawyers can collect information from the truck's "blackbox" in addition to physical evidence. This is vital for any case involving a truck accident. It holds all kinds of data, from the truck's speed to the tire pressure to whether or not the brakes were applied.

This information isn't easy to obtain from a trucking firm, so you need an attorney to assist you. This information will assist the lawyer who was involved in the accident determine the cause of the accident and can be used to calculate your future medical costs and lost wages.

Negotiating with the Insurance Company

Often, you will have to negotiate with the insurance company for compensation. You can get a decent amount of money from this process to cover the damages you have suffered due to the accident.

A good lawyer can ensure that the insurance company offers you a fair and acceptable offer. They can also assist you to create a settlement demand.

Your truck accident lawyer can assist you in gathering details about the amount of money that you deserve to be paid out for your injuries. This information could include past medical expenses, future medical expenses expected and lost wages, damages to property, as well as other damages you've suffered as a a result.

Once you have all this information, your attorney will send an Demand letter to the insurance company. In this letter, you'll indicate the amount you'd like to be compensated for your injuries.

When an insurance company initially begins to discuss options with you, they'll usually try to make you a low-ball offer. This is to make you accept it quickly.

You can counter this by maintaining a level-headed attitude and considering their offer objectively. It is better to be willing to compromise and accept a fair settlement rather than bow to pressure or deception.

Keep records of all conversations with an insurance adjuster. Ideally the records should contain all discussions that took place in person as well as over the phone.

Keep receipts for any costs you incur as a result of the incident. This includes ambulance transport or emergency room treatment, any over-the- prescription medications, and any other purchases.

This will provide your lawyer with a clear understanding of the real costs of your injuries. This will allow them to create a thorough demand for settlement that is more likely be successful in court.

Going to Court

It is imperative to act quickly and seek the help that you need in the event that you or someone you care about has been injured in an accident involving trucks. The earlier you start the legal process and get it started, the more likely you'll be able recover damages.

A lawyer for truck accidents will guide you through the legal process, and help you determine who is responsible for the accident. They will also ensure that you get the compensation you deserve.

After an accident, get all the evidence you can. This includes police reports as well as medical records. It is a lengthy process, but it can help in making the best case.

Your lawyer will examine the evidence to determine who was accountable for the accident. You may decide to bring a lawsuit against the driver or the trucking company or both.

You may also be capable of suing the manufacturer of the defective component. This could be referred as design liability or product liability.

Other parties that are liable could be a maintenance company that failed to fix an issue before it caused an accident or a local county that manages the stretch of road where the collision occurred.

It is vital to determine who was accountable for the accident prior to making your claim. A lawyer will help in this process by assembling all the evidence needed and talking to people who witnessed the accident.

After the investigation is complete and you are ready to make a claim with the court to request a trial date. During the trial your lawyer for a truck accident will present evidence and present your legal options to the judge.

Your lawyer will also explain any deadlines that apply to your case, and how to ensure that you don't miss them. For instance, if the case involves an agency of the government that requires you to give notice prior filing your claim You must notify them as soon as possible after the accident.
